About me
“Anna Grace” Crawford is a New York City based Actor, Singer, and Creative. As of May, she has received her Bachelor of Fine Arts in Acting for Theatre, Film & Television at Long Island University Brooklyn in association with The New Group.
Originally from Dallas-Fort Worth, Texas, she grew up studying theatre, music, and dance. Anna Grace attended Booker T Washington High School for the Performing and Visual Arts in Dallas, Texas where she was able to study acting in a conservatory styled setting and prioritize her art while also studying dance, voice, and technical theatre.
Anna Grace plans to pursue her art in as many avenues, genres, and styles as possible. With a deep love and commitment to classical theatre, she also seeks to explore more of her passion for new/experimental work, both on stage and on camera.
In her free time, you will find Anna Grace reading at Prospect Park, sketching forms, attempting to teach herself a new instrument, up-cycling her clothes, or writing music.
